Topics Covered
- 1. Introduction to Fleet Operations: Learners will study the basics of fleet operations, including vehicle types, logistics, and operational challenges. They will gain foundational knowledge to understand the complexities of managing vehicle fleets.
- 2. Fundamentals of Routing Algorithms: Learners will explore basic routing algorithms and their applications in fleet management, focusing on key concepts like shortest path and time windows. Practical skills include implementing simple routing algorithms.
- 3. Optimization Techniques for Fleet Routing: This module covers advanced optimization techniques used to enhance fleet efficiency, such as linear programming and heuristics. Learners will understand how to apply these techniques to real-world problems.
- 4. Advanced Routing Algorithms: Learners will delve into more complex routing algorithms, including vehicle routing problems with time windows (VRPTW) and capacitated vehicle routing problems (CVRP). Skills include designing and implementing advanced routing solutions.
- 5. Geospatial Data and Analysis: This module focuses on the use of geospatial data in fleet optimization, including GIS tools and spatial analysis techniques. Learners will gain the ability to analyze and visualize fleet data effectively.
- 6. Data Structures and Algorithms for Optimization: Learners will study data structures and algorithms essential for fleet optimization, such as graphs and trees. Practical skills include selecting and implementing appropriate data structures for optimization problems.
- 7. Software Development for Fleet Optimization: This module covers the development of software solutions for fleet optimization, including programming languages and frameworks. Learners will learn to develop and test software applications for fleet management.
- 8. Machine Learning in Fleet Optimization: Learners will explore the application of machine learning techniques in fleet optimization, including predictive modeling and clustering. Practical skills include using machine learning algorithms to optimize fleet operations.
- 9. Case Studies in Fleet Optimization: This module includes detailed case studies of real-world fleet optimization projects. Learners will analyze these cases to understand successful implementation strategies and challenges.
- 10. Project Management and Implementation: Learners will learn the skills needed to manage and implement fleet optimization projects, including project planning, stakeholder engagement, and continuous improvement. Practical skills include developing and managing a fleet optimization project from start to finish.
